Quito is not a place for amatures. Yes you do have to abandon the GS (3.2deg) at 664 DH and transition to the PAPIs (3.0deg). That requires about a 1200-1500 FPM initial sink close to the ground to intercept the normal visual slope. Eng out considerations are VERY important considering the pressure altitude and terrain. There are people that make a living picking up aluminum off the sides of mountains there. Quito is usually a special qualification airport for airlines.
